The ABC Revival (2016–2021)
The most recent version of Match Game, hosted by Alec Baldwin, aired on ABC from 2016 to 2021 across five seasons and 65 episodes. These episodes feature rotating celebrity panels of contemporary comedians, actors, and personalities playing the classic fill-in-the-blank format with modern production values and humor. If you're looking for a polished, current take on the show that's easy to jump into, the ABC revival is the ideal starting point. Each episode is self-contained, so you can watch in any order without needing backstory.

Classic Match Game Episodes (1970s–1980s)
For fans who want to experience the legendary 1970s version with Gene Rayburn, Charles Nelson Reilly, and Brett Somers, options are more limited but still accessible. Buzzer, the game show-focused streaming channel, has aired classic Match Game episodes in its programming. Select episodes from the original run also appear on YouTube, both through official channels and fan uploads that capture the show's golden era. Game Show Network (GSN) periodically airs classic Match Game episodes in their programming schedule — check your local listings for current air times. For collectors, some classic Match Game seasons have been released on DVD, available through online retailers.

International Versions
Match Game's format has been licensed to dozens of countries worldwide, each producing their own local version. If you're interested in seeing how different cultures interpret the fill-in-the-blank format, international versions can sometimes be found on YouTube or through region-specific streaming platforms. The UK, Australia, and Canada have all produced notable versions with their own distinct flavor, and these international takes often feature questions and humor tailored to local audiences.
